Using the Digital Zoom

SCN1 SCN2

In the [REC] menu (P78), setting [D.ZOOM] to [2k] or [4k] allows you to magnify a subject up to a maximum of 48 times. (Except when using extra optical zoom.)

The indicated zoom magnification is an approximation.

When using the digital zoom, the AF area is displayed with a size wider than usual and set only to a point on the centre of the screen. (P86)

The digital zoom is temporarily set to [OFF] in the following cases.

When taking pictures in auto mode [ ] (P41)

When the quality is set to [RAW] (P83)

When [CONVERSION] on the [REC] menu is set to [ ] (P92)

When using the digital zoom, the picture quality becomes deteriorated.

When using the digital zoom, the stabilizer function may not be effective.

When using the digital zoom, we recommend using a tripod and the self-timer (P52) for taking pictures.
